Item 5.02 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ers.

On July 31, 2012, the Board of Directors of Green Mountain Coffee Roasters, Inc. (the “Company”) increased the number of directors of the Company from eight to nine and appointed Norman H. Wesley to serve as a director of the Company.  A copy of the press release containing the announcement of Mr. Wesley’s appointment is attached as Exhibit 99.1.

Mr. Wesley will participate in the standard compensation plan for non-employee directors, including a pro-rata portion of the Director’s annual retainer and equity grant of options and restricted stock units, as described in the Company’s proxy statement fil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ission. There is no arrangement or understanding pursuant to which Mr. Wesley was elected as a director, and there are no related party transactions between the Company and Mr. Wesley that would require disclosure under Item 404(a) of Regulation S-K.

Green Mountain Coffee Roasters, Inc. Adds Norman H. Wesley, Former CEO and Chairman of Fortune Brands, to Board of Directors

WATERBURY, Vt.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--August 1, 2012--Green Mountain Coffee Roasters, Inc., (GMCR) (NASDAQ: GMCR), a leader in specialty coffee and coffee makers, today announced that Norman H. Wesley, former CEO and Chairman of Fortune Brands, Inc., has joined its Board of Directors. Effective immediately Mr. Wesley will be a Class II Director with a term that expires at the Company’s 2013 Annual Meeting where he will stand for election by shareholders. His addition expands GMCR’s Board of Directors to nine members, seven of whom are independent.

“Norm has significant operational and strategic expertise from more than 20 years as a senior executive, including as Chief Executive Officer of a multinational, multi-channel and multi-branded publicly traded consumer products company,” said Michael J. Mardy, interim Chairman of GMCR’s Board of Directors. “In particular, we believe his financial expertise will further enhance the ability of the Board to oversee and monitor the Company’s strategic planning as GMCR pursues opportunities for continued growth including leveraging its core competencies into adjacent categories.”

Lawrence Blanford, GMCR’s CEO, added: “The management team looks forward to Norm’s insight and guidance.”

Mr. Wesley’s appointment is the first resulting action from an ongoing comprehensive governance review overseen by the Board’s Governance and Nominating Committee to further enhance the skills, experience and attributes of the Board of Directors as a whole, and its individual members, as the Company evolves. The Committee has retained advisors to assist the Board, the committee and management in this review.

“GMCR’s Board of Directors is focused on advancing its corporate governance in support of protecting and enhancing the interests of the Company’s shareholders while working to assure the long-term operating success of the business,” continued Mr. Mardy. “The Board will continue to evaluate optimum Board and committee composition and structure as it proceeds through this comprehensive governance review.”

Mr. Wesley joined Fortune Brands, Inc. in 1984 as part of the acquisition of the company's former office products subsidiary. For more than ten years he led the office products unit, which Fortune Brands spun off to shareholders in 2005. Mr. Wesley became CEO of the company's home and hardware business in 1997, President and COO of Fortune Brands in January 1999, and Chairman and CEO of Fortune Brands in December 1999. He served as CEO through December 2007, and remained Chairman until retiring in September 2008. Mr. Wesley began his career at Crown Zellerbach Corporation, where over a ten-year period he held various management positions, including Vice President and General Manager of the Office Products Group, before joining Fortune Brands, Inc.

Mr. Wesley currently serves on the boards of ACCO Brands Corporation, Acuity Brands, Inc. and Fortune Brands Home & Security, Inc. He received a B.S. in finance and an M.B.A. from the University of Utah.
